| Personal Interview: Common questions to expect and how to answer themBefore going inside the interview room, be well versed with the most favorite and popular questions among the panelists which you are most likely to face.
By: MBA Universe Tell us about yourself From this question, the interviewer wants to derive how well you can summarize your personality in few minutes. You should arrange the points in the following manner while telling the panel about yourself: 1) Talk about the Work experience or Academic details that you would like to share with the panel. 2) Talk about the Personal details that could be of interest. Like where you stay/lived family details (that could lead to questions); your hobbies and interests, your successes/achievements, strengths/weaknesses etc. Do not exaggerate a particular point. Dr. Sanghamitra Buddhapriya, Admission Convener of FORE School of Management says, “Keep your introduction crisp. Talk about your achievements, interests and hobbies. But don’t appear over confident.” Questions on Education You should be well versed on your graduation subjects. The panel expects you to know your subjects well. Check the subject which you have mentioned as your favorite in the Application form/SOP. You should be prepared to answer any kind of question on your favorite subject. If you are asked about your favorite subject during the interview, think before you speak because in all possibilities you will face an array of questions on that. Questions on your profession If you have work experience, then you should be able to talk on your job profile, duties and responsibilities in your organization. You should also know about your company, its position in the market and other details. Also be prepared to talk about the industry or sector you work in. You should also have some knowledge about the other prominent companies in that industry or sector. Why do you want to pursue MBA? Why this institute? You will have to be very careful while answering these two most common questions. You can face various counter questions as well. About why you want to do an MBA, you should never cite the reason as ‘for getting a good job and high pay package’. “Please focus on the need to do an MBA - like gaining specific skills or to change a career or cite the fact that you are pursuing an interest,” advises Sai Kumar Swamy, Course Director, T.I.M.E. “The more specific the better will be the answer,” he adds. Questions on Hobbies/Interests You can face questions on the hobbies and interest you have. You should gather in-depth knowledge about your interests on which you can get a question to answer. It can be anything on your favorite sport, sportsman, music, literature, movies to activities like cooking. “I mentioned cooking as my hobby and I was asked what ajinomoto is!” said an IIM Ahmedabad student while mentoring GD-PI call getters. Personal background Apart from educational and professional background, you can also face questions on your personal background like your childhood, city, family etc. Questions based on the GD/Essay writing rounds Your performance in the GD/Essay writing will most probably be discussed during the PI round. You can be asked to justify a particular point which you have mentioned in the GD/essay or a particular gesture or overall behavior during the GD. Make sure you have enough reasons to validate your point. Answering embarrassing questions While answering the questions, which might embarrass you, such as about low marks in boards or graduation, gap in between years etc., try to be as polite, calm and composed as possible. For these questions, never criticize a former teacher, friend, colleague or the society and system as a whole. Try to justify as well as possible. After all, everyone faces failures at some point or the other. By asking you such inappropriate questions, the aim of the panel is mostly to provoke you but in such cases, your reaction will speak more than your words. End
